Unlike traditional injection-molded pickleballs, DigiPro is digitally manufactured to deliver superior durability, consistency, and significantly reduced acoustic output while maintaining competitive play performance.
Our ball is produced using HP Multi Jet Fusion (MJF), an industrial powder-bed fusion additive manufacturing process that builds each part through digitally controlled, layer-by-layer fusion. Unlike injection or roto molding, MJF enables complex internal lattice structures that would otherwise be impossible to manufacture, while maintaining precise control over geometry throughout the entire ball. The result is uniform material density.
The lattice structure absorbs and distributes impact energy differently than a solid shell — reducing the sharp "crack" of traditional pickleballs into a softer click. This acoustic reduction is what earns the DigiPro its USA Pickleball Quiet Play certification.
Every DigiPro ball is produced from the same digital file, with tolerances that do not vary over time. This means the 100th ball is identical to the 1st — something injection molding simply cannot guarantee as molds wear.
